The majority of forklifts have a three-point suspension system that consists of two front wheels and a pivot point at the back axle. Together, these points create a "stability triangular" that lessens the risk that a lift will certainly tip over, even on high or tough surface.


If the lift is progressing or backwards or parked on a slope, its facility of gravity shifts. In this instance, the forklift's center of mass drops outside the security triangular. The result: the lift will topple. A forklift's center of gravity moves at any time a lift driver accelerates, brakes, or turns.

Forklifts are ranked for loads at a defined maximum weight and a defined onward center of mass. Producers measure and examination forklifts and assign these specifications to safeguard drivers from accidents and rollovers. A lot of storage facility forklifts have tons capacities between one and five heaps. Some larger forklifts can raise up to 50 tons (these are meant for heavier commercial applications such as delivering containers).

Pallet jacks are the easiest and many fundamental forklift design featuring 2 forks normally 20 1/4 inches or 27 inches vast. Their standard feature is restricted to moving pallets inside a stockroom. Pallet jacks normally have steering wheels in the front, and each fork has either a single wheel or two bogie wheels.


A lot of pallet jacks are developed to manage about 5,000 pounds typically, and some designs have the ability to raise to 8,000 pounds. There are 3 typical sorts of pallet jacks: Hand-operated pallet jacks are hand-powered by the operator and made use of to lift, lower, and steer pallets from one place to one more.

Walkie stackers are an additional straightforward layout including a pole that allows lifting payloads to higher heights than pallet jacks. Walkie stackers are usually stated to be a blend of a pallet jack and forklift - since they have an easy design and deal with (comparable to a pallet jack) while providing reach (similar to a forklift).


Operators commonly guide and maneuver the walkie stacker around the stockroom by pulling the manage. A lot of walkie stackers are developed to manage between 2,000 and 3,000 lbs on standard, with some versions raising up to 4,000 pounds (forklift dealer watkinsville, ga). Lift elevations differ based upon make and model and usually range in between 6 and 14 feet

Order pickers are designed to handle 1 or 2 units and a driver instead of raising a whole pallet. Operators trip in a system that increases and lowers them to various degrees of storehouse racks. Order pickers help operators "choose their orders" inside stockrooms the operator utilizes the order picker to promptly and efficiently recover and store items at varying elevations inside a storage facility.
